Decimal Odds
Decimal odds provide a straightforward representation of betting odds, commonly used in Europe and Australia, especially in soccer betting. For example, if a team has decimal odds of 2.50, it means that for every unit you stake, you will receive 2.50 units back if the bet is successful.
American Odds
On the other hand, American odds are prevalent in the United States and are primarily utilized in sports like basketball and football. This format uses either a positive or negative number to indicate potential payout, making it easier to understand the potential profits or amount needed to win per $100 wager.
Implied Probability
Understanding sports betting odds also involves grasping the concept of implied probability, which refers to the likelihood of an outcome as suggested by the odds. Calculating the implied probability allows you to gauge whether the odds represent value or not, giving you a clearer view of potential outcomes.
Shopping for the Best Odds
Shopping for the best odds is also crucial. As different sportsbooks may offer slightly different odds for the same event, taking the time to compare and find the most favorable odds can significantly impact your overall profitability in the long run.
